如图正常提示进入,并显示正确端口号,则表示服务已经启动。 如果安装的时候加入环境变量的话 可以直接使用redis-cli来连接redis服务器 二、Nodejs中使用Redis Nodejs 中Redis模块:https://github.com/NodeRedis/node_redis 1、在你的项目中安装Redisnpm install redis --save 或
删除使用del。 del key 我把刚刚创建的name这条数据给删掉了。 此时使用get或者keys *都差不回name这条数据了。 以上就是Redis的基础用法。 二、NodeJS 操作 Redis 初始化项目 我用默认模板初始化项目。 npm init -y 安装Redis 依赖 npm install redis 如果你想用旧版语法,可以安装指定版本。 比如2.8版 npm ...
使用Node.js连接redis 代码语言:javascript 代码运行次数:0 运行 AI代码解释 constredis=require('redis');constclient=redis.createClient(6379,'127.0.0.1'); 由于是消息队列,于是需要有一个生产者、消费者 ❝这里普及下消息队列的使用,跟redis一样,都是属于进程外的服务,就是单独要占用一个端口起服务的 ❞ ...
刚开始使用的是node-redis这个库,其对应的github地址是:https:///NodeRedis/node-redis,npm官网地址是:https://www.npmjs.com/package/node-redis,后来发现了国内阿里的一个Nodejs的redis库,其npm官网地址是:https://www.npmjs.com/package/ioredis,ioredis库比node-redis更新维护快并且比较新,所以就改用ioredi...
首先,导入 Redis以便它可以通过 createClient 使用。 每当用户访问我们的文章端点时,我们都会加载 Redis,而不是直接跳转到解析和显示文章。 我们检查 Redis 数据库中的两个键(await client.get('key-name'))。一个键是 req.currentUrl。例如,此页面可能是/article/redis-caching-ssr-site-nodejs. 另一个是过期...
node使用redis redis下载: https:///tporadowski/redis/releases 通过命令行使用: 通过node访问redis: const redis = require('redis') const redisClient = redis.createClient() redisClient.on('error', (err) => console.log('Redis redisClient Error', err))...
需要强调的是,在node中,是通过底层socket的**_writev**实现一次发送多条redis命令的,_writev又叫做聚合写,它支持将不同缓冲区的多条数据通过一次系统调用写入目标流,因此性能上比每次写单个缓冲区的单个数据来的好得多。在node的Writeable对象中,有cork和uncork方法,通过这两个方法可以在node write stream中缓存多条...
这就是 redis 的使用和在 nodejs 里操作 redis 的方式。 回到最开始的问题,我们完全可以查出数据来之后放到 redis 中缓存,下次如果 redis 有数据就直接用,没有的话就查数据库然后更新 redis 缓存。 这是redis 的第一种用途,作为数据库的缓存。 第二种用途就是直接作为存储数据的地方了,因为 redis 本身是会做...
Node.js是一个运行在服务器端的JavaScript运行时环境,而Redis是一个开源的内存键值对数据库。在Node.js中使用Redis主要是通过Redis的官方Node.js客户端库redis来实现的。 下面是使用Node.js连接和操作Redis的具体步骤: 1. 安装Redis和redis模块 首先需要在你的服务器上安装Redis数据库,并启动Redis服务。安装Redis的过...
打开一个 cmd 窗口,进入目录到 D:redis,运行 redis-server.exe redis.windows.conf。 出现上面界面,则redis已经在本机端口6379启动了服务,那么接下来,便可以用客户端连接到redis服务端了。 在node中使用redis 首先,安装驱动:npm install redis redis支持多种数据类型,常用的有键/值对,哈希表,链表,集合等。